本書以AT89S系列單片機為核心元件,以單片機系統(tǒng)開發(fā)為背景,以設(shè)計實例為依托,從工程需求講解單片機的相關(guān)知識;選用PF'.OTEUS、Keil仿真軟件為平臺,調(diào)試、仿真應(yīng)用程序;采用通用板制作和Protel99SE制板相結(jié)合的方式焊接電路。實例包括單片機I/O接口的應(yīng)用、中斷的使用、定時器/計數(shù)器的應(yīng)用、串行接口的應(yīng)用、看門狗的應(yīng)用等,外圍設(shè)備包括LED、點陣、鍵盤、數(shù)碼管、LCD、DSl302、AT24c02、DSl8820、直流電機、步進電機等,同時給出了單片機作為下位機與上位機通信以便擴展應(yīng)用的方法。
本書以工程應(yīng)用為背景,內(nèi)容針對性強,可以作為電子信息類專業(yè)本科及研究生學(xué)習(xí)單片機的教材,也可供相關(guān)的科研人員和從事單片機系統(tǒng)開發(fā)的技術(shù)人員閱讀和參考。
第1章 基于PROTEUS的單片機系統(tǒng)仿真
1.1 PROTEUS ISIS編輯環(huán)境
1.1.1 PROTEUS ISIS操作界面
1.1.2 主菜單和主工具欄
1.1.3 PROTEUS ISIS編輯環(huán)境設(shè)置
1.1.4 PROTEUS ISIS系統(tǒng)參數(shù)設(shè)置
1.2 電路圖繪制
1.2.1 繪圖工具
1.2.2 導(dǎo)線的操作
1.2.3 對象的操作
1.2.4 PROTEUS電路繪制實例
1.2.5 電路圖繪制進階
1.3 電路分析與仿真’
1.3.1 激勵源
1.3.2 虛擬儀器
第1章 基于PROTEUS的單片機系統(tǒng)仿真
1.1 PROTEUS ISIS編輯環(huán)境
1.1.1 PROTEUS ISIS操作界面
1.1.2 主菜單和主工具欄
1.1.3 PROTEUS ISIS編輯環(huán)境設(shè)置
1.1.4 PROTEUS ISIS系統(tǒng)參數(shù)設(shè)置
1.2 電路圖繪制
1.2.1 繪圖工具
1.2.2 導(dǎo)線的操作
1.2.3 對象的操作
1.2.4 PROTEUS電路繪制實例
1.2.5 電路圖繪制進階
1.3 電路分析與仿真’
1.3.1 激勵源
1.3.2 虛擬儀器
1.3.3 探針
1.3.4 圖表
1.3.5 基于圖表的仿真
1.3.6 交互式仿真
1.4 基于PROTEUS的51單片機仿真——源代碼控制系統(tǒng)
1.4.1 在PROTEUS VSM中創(chuàng)建源代碼文件
1.4.2 編輯源代碼程序
1.4.3 生成目標(biāo)代碼文件
1.4.4 代碼生成工具
1.4.5 定義第三方源代碼編輯器
1.4.6 使用第三方IDE
1.5 基于PROTEUS的51單片機仿真——源代碼調(diào)試
……